Transaction 6510330614b462e5cc54da434081136d3e4624c6bcf77b9562ba0f73241a0ea9
1 Input
1 Output
-
6510330614b462e5cc54da434081136d3e4624c6bcf77b9562ba0f73241a0ea9:0
- value
- 203340
- script pubkey
- OP_0 OP_PUSHBYTES_20 86e571123ef6ca8391464e56de3703a9019ed414
- address
- bc1qsmjhzy377m9g8y2xfetdudcr4yqea4q552psgq